As an HCC (Hierarchical Condition Category) coder you will review medical records to identify and code diagnoses using a standardized system, ensuring accurate representation of patient conditions for risk adjustment and reimbursement purposes. You will play a critical role in translating clinical documentation into precise codes that reflect the complexity and severity of a patient's health status.

You Will

  • Review, analyze, and code diagnostic information in a patient's medical record based on client specific guidelines for the project.
  • The coder will ensure compliance with established ICD-10 CM, third party reimbursement policies, regulations and accreditation guidelines.
  • Coders must meet and maintain a 95% coding accuracy rate.
  • Any other task requested by leadership.


What You Will Bring To The Table

  • AHIMA certified credentials (RHIA, RHIT, CCS) or AAPC certified credentials (CPC, CPC-H, COC, CIC, or CRC).
  • A minimum of 2 years HCC coding experience, while certified.
  • Full understanding and knowledge of ICD-10, medical terminology, medical abbreviations, pharmacology and disease processes.
  • Ability to be flexible in the work environment.
  • Ability to work in a fast paced production environment while maintaining high quality.
  • Must be able to follow instructions, meet deadlines and work independently.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, problem solve, ability to work in a remote environment, and time management skills.
  • Working knowledge of the business use of computer hardware and software to ensure effectiveness and quality of the processing and security of the data.
  • Must be able to use Microsoft Office with no training.
  • Ability to be able work on multiple client projects simultaneously, if needed.


This position has a base pay of $19.60 plus the option to earn up to $3.25 per chart based on quality and production.
